QUASAR POLARIZATION FEATURES
description In the present contribution we study the influence of dust particles on the polarization properties of the radiation that propagates along the jet in ADNs. Firts, a model for describing the interaction of dust particles, besides the electrons and ions with electromagnetic radiation in a magneto-active plasma has been developed. From here, the contribution of dust parcicles to the Faraday rotation of the plane of polarization of the electric vector can be deduced, expression that is evaluaten for the AGN torus and for the outer region of the jet separately, regions where the presence of dust particles are assumed.
